rep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Release 1.6.372
2008-11-21
Chris
R
obinson
Release 1
.
6
.
372
commit
|
commitdiff
|
tree
2008-11-21
C
h
r
is Robinson
Wait u
n
til one full fragment is em
p
ty before
mixing
commit
|
commitdiff
|
tree
2008-11-21
Chr
i
s Robi
n
son
Make the DSo
u
nd
e
mulated fragme
n
t coun
t
configurab
l
e
commit
|
commitdiff
|
tree
2008-11-20
C
h
r
is Robin
s
o
n
Fix a c
o
mment
commit
|
commitdiff
|
tree
2008-11-19
Chris Robinson
Fix early reflection
in
p
ut
commit
|
commitdiff
|
tree
2008-11-19
Chris Ro
b
inson
Han
d
l
e ALSA capture
e
rrors
a bit better
commit
|
commitdiff
|
tree
2008-11-18
C
h
ris Robinson
Sim
p
lif
y
in-sample low-pass filter
c
oe
f
ficient calcu
l
ation
commit
|
commitdiff
|
tree
2008-11-18
Chris
R
obinson
Fix
lo
w
-pass coefficien
t
calculation
commit
|
commitdiff
|
tree
2008-11-18
Chri
s
Robinson
Don't
calc
u
l
ate r
e
verb HF limit
i
f a
i
r absorption is 1
commit
|
commitdiff
|
tree
2008-11-18
Chris Robinson
Non-
c
ross
-
compiled DLLs should
n
't have lib prefixed
commit
|
commitdiff
|
tree
2008-11-17
Chri
s
R
o
binso
n
Remove
o
utda
t
ed commen
t
s and
a
dd copyright he
a
der
commit
|
commitdiff
|
tree
2008-11-16
Chr
i
s Robi
n
son
D
irectSound is n
o
t exp
l
icitly dependant on windows
.
h
commit
|
commitdiff
|
tree
2008-11-16
Chris Robinson
R
e
m
ove un
n
eeded mac
r
o
commit
|
commitdiff
|
tree
2008-11-16
Chris
Robi
n
son
Use a better dB-to-line
a
r
g
ain
conver
t
ion
commit
|
commitdiff
|
tree
2008-11-16
C
h
ris Rob
i
nson
Imp
l
e
m
e
nt a new reverb
e
ffec
t
commit
|
commitdiff
|
tree
2008-11-14
Chris
Robinson
A
dd an o
p
t
i
on to disable specific EFX effect types
commit
|
commitdiff
|
tree
2008-11-14
Chris Robinson
A
d
d cross-compiling op
t
ion
commit
|
commitdiff
|
tree
2008-11-13
Chris Robin
s
on
Allow
s
pecifying ano
t
her config fi
l
e
with the ALS
O
FT_CONF
.
.
.
commit
|
commitdiff
|
tree
2008-11-13
Chris Robinson
Don't ramp gains
w
hen start
i
ng
a sound from
t
he beginn
i
ng
commit
|
commitdiff
|
tree
2008-11-12
Chris Robinson
A
v
oid unnecessary
float
i
ng-
p
oint math
commit
|
commitdiff
|
tree
2008-11-11
Chris R
o
binson
Add in
i
ti
a
l AL_EXTX_buffer_su
b
_d
a
t
a support
commit
|
commitdiff
|
tree
2008-11-06
Chr
i
s Robinson
F
i
x
Win32 thr
e
ad handle
leak
commit
|
commitdiff
|
tree
2008-11-02
Chris
R
o
binson
Be
m
ore flexibl
e
wi
t
h channel count when loading IMA4
.
.
.
commit
|
commitdiff
|
tree
2008-11-02
Chri
s
Robinson
Seperate data converters
i
nto reusable f
u
ncti
o
ns
commit
|
commitdiff
|
tree
2008-11-01
Chris
Rob
i
nson
More padding fixes
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
More b
u
f
fer conversion refact
o
ring
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
P
adding is
n
ot dependant on the
f
re
q
uency c
u
t
o
f
f anymore
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
Restructu
r
e
buffer
data
co
n
version code a
bit
commit
|
commitdiff
|
tree
2008-10-28
Chris Robin
s
o
n
Fix typo
preve
n
ting
c
apture from o
p
ening
commit
|
commitdiff
|
tree
2008-10-25
C
h
ris Robinson
Ap
p
end the driver and its ver
s
ion to the AL version
.
.
.
commit
|
commitdiff
|
tree
2008-10-25
Chris Robinson
Make sure an appr
o
priate error is s
e
t
w
he
n
o
p
e
ning
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
Chris Robinson
Use pl
u
ghw for capture
s
o ALSA can c
o
nvert capture
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
Chris Robinso
n
Includ
e
f
loat
.
h if it
exi
s
ts, for _RC_CHOP and _MCW_R
C
commit
|
commitdiff
|
tree
2008-10-10
C
h
r
i
s
Robins
o
n
Remove another
u
nused source
mem
b
er
commit
|
commitdiff
|
tree
2008-10-10
Chris Robins
o
n
U
se a modulo to keep the buffer positio
n
in r
a
nge f
o
r
.
.
.
commit
|
commitdiff
|
tree
2008-10-10
Ch
r
is Robinson
Clamp source position to the buffer s
i
ze when it s
t
ops
commit
|
commitdiff
|
tree
2008-10-10
Chri
s
Robinson
Remove unneeded sou
r
ce
m
e
mber variable
commit
|
commitdiff
|
tree
2008-10-10
C
h
r
i
s Robinson
Commit
m
issing c
h
anges
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
Only send one channel through the wet
p
ath
commit
|
commitdiff
|
tree
2008-10-09
Chris Rob
i
n
s
o
n
Increase max pitch to
65536
commit
|
commitdiff
|
tree
2008-10-09
Chris Rob
i
nson
S
impli
f
y the lerp f
u
nction
commit
|
commitdiff
|
tree
2008-10-09
C
h
ris Robinson
Don't apply
the wet
p
a
t
h for
m
u
l
ti-channel
b
u
f
f
ers
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
S
k
ip mixing if the read position is beyond the e
n
d
.
.
.
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
T
h
e wet path should be sile
n
t if no effect
is set on
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
Chris Rob
i
nson
Don
'
t h
o
ld the whole-numbe
r
posi
t
ion in
the fractional
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
Chris Robins
o
n
Use
a new low-pass fil
t
er,
b
ased on the I3
D
L2 spec
commit
|
commitdiff
|
tree
2008-09-30
Chris Robinson
Implement non-mmap
A
LS
A
c
a
ptu
r
e
commit
|
commitdiff
|
tree
2008-09-23
Chris Robinson
Air absorption fact
o
r is applied
to the dB value, not
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Chris Robi
n
son
Add a variable to over
r
i
d
e the
def
a
u
l
t
l
i
brar
y
t
y
pe
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Chris
R
o
b
inson
F
i
xup some source
para
m
eter calculations
commit
|
commitdiff
|
tree
2008-09-16
Chris
Robinson
F
i
x fu
n
cti
o
n p
o
i
n
ter declarations
commit
|
commitdiff
|
tree
2008-09-13
Chris Robinson
Use a 12dB/oct rolloff
i
n
stead of 24 for the lowpa
s
s
.
.
.
commit
|
commitdiff
|
tree
2008-09-13
Chris Robin
s
o
n
Store pi as
a s
t
atic const
commit
|
commitdiff
|
tree
2008-09-13
Chris Robinson
Fix
typo to
ge
t
t
he p
r
oper minor ALC version
commit
|
commitdiff
|
tree
2008-09-13
Chr
i
s Robin
s
on
P
r
int EFX info when
the extension
i
s available
commit
|
commitdiff
|
tree
2008-09-07
Chris Robinson
Add a Solaris p
l
ayback b
a
ckend
commit
|
commitdiff
|
tree
2008-09-06
Chri
s
R
ob
i
n
son
Cl
e
ar t
h
e en
d
of the
b
uff
e
r when
a
t
th
e
end of t
h
e
.
.
.
commit
|
commitdiff
|
tree
2008-09-06
Chri
s
Robinson
Don't exp
o
rt extension function sy
m
bols f
r
om
t
he l
i
b
commit
|
commitdiff
|
tree
2008-08-16
Chri
s
Robinson
Remove
unneed
e
d
source stru
c
t member
commit
|
commitdiff
|
tree
2008-08-15
Chris
Rob
i
nson
Clear channel vo
l
umes w
h
e
n
startin
g
a so
u
rce
commit
|
commitdiff
|
tree
2008-08-15
Chr
i
s Robinson
Overw
r
i
t
e the inpu
t
wet s
a
mple wi
t
h the outpu
t
commit
|
commitdiff
|
tree
2008-08-14
Chris Robinso
n
Allow setting the EF
X
dopp
l
e
r
fact
o
r so
u
rce prope
r
ty
commit
|
commitdiff
|
tree
2008-08-14
Chris R
o
b
inson
Ra
m
p
channel gains
to remo
v
e pops and clicks from abrupt
.
.
.
commit
|
commitdiff
|
tree
2008-08-08
Chris
Robinson
I
n
clu
d
e fenv
.
h if it ex
i
sts for fese
t
round
commit
|
commitdiff
|
tree
2008-08-08
Chris R
o
binson
S
e
t
FPU mode to roun
d
t
oward
z
ero for mixing
commit
|
commitdiff
|
tree
2008-08-08
Ch
r
is Robin
s
on
Remo
v
e unne
c
essary casting
commit
|
commitdiff
|
tree
2008-08-06
Chris Ro
b
inson
P
rev
e
nt
a
0
o
r negative increment
f
o
r t
h
e buffer po
s
i
tion
commit
|
commitdiff
|
tree
2008-08-06
Chri
s
Robinson
Pass a du
m
my variable to CreateThread to
s
atisfy Win9x
commit
|
commitdiff
|
tree
2008-07-28
Chris Robinson
R
e
lease 1
.
5
.
304
commit
|
commitdiff
|
tree
2008-07-27
Chris R
o
b
inson
Reduce the def
a
u
l
t
bu
f
fer siz
e
to 4096
commit
|
commitdiff
|
tree
2008-07-27
C
h
ris Robinson
Improve gettin
g
and setting EFX filter parameters
commit
|
commitdiff
|
tree
2008-07-27
Chris Robin
s
on
Use arrays
i
n
s
t
ead of
po
i
nter-to-arrays
for the low
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Chris Robinson
Fix so
m
e calculation
s
fo
r
th
e
reverb
buffer
commit
|
commitdiff
|
tree
2008-07-26
Chris Robinson
Ma
k
e the
filter proc
e
ss
i
n
g
function i
n
l
i
ne
commit
|
commitdiff
|
tree
2008-07-26
C
hris Robins
o
n
Implem
e
n
t y
e
t
another low-pass
f
i
l
t
e
r
commit
|
commitdiff
|
tree
2008-07-24
Chris R
o
binso
n
Use a temp pointer when realloc
(
)
ing
commit
|
commitdiff
|
tree
2008-07-24
C
h
r
is Robinson
Sp
e
c
i
fy pad
d
ing per b
u
ffer, and ma
k
e sure i
t
'
s
larg
e
.
.
.
commit
|
commitdiff
|
tree
2008-07-24
Chris Robinson
Don't ad
v
ert
i
se extr
a
s
amples for mixi
n
g
commit
|
commitdiff
|
tree
2008-07-24
Chris Robinso
n
Implement
a
n
a
lternative low-pass
filter
commit
|
commitdiff
|
tree
2008-07-23
Chr
i
s Ro
b
inson
Make sure the
c
orrect
libname i
s
used
fo
r
pkg-config
commit
|
commitdiff
|
tree
2008-07-23
Chris Robinson
Add a w
a
rning
when bu
i
lding on W
i
ndows with the DSo
u
nd
.
.
.
commit
|
commitdiff
|
tree
2008-07-23
C
h
ris Robinson
Add
a pkg-c
o
nf
i
g file to i
n
st
a
l
l on the system
commit
|
commitdiff
|
tree
2008-07-22
Chris Robins
o
n
A
dd AL_LOKI
_
IMA_ADPCM_format and AL_EXT_vorbis tokens
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Chris
R
obinso
n
Clarify impli
c
it
d
estructi
o
n warnings
commit
|
commitdiff
|
tree
2008-07-22
Chris Robins
o
n
Mo
v
e
A
LC_ENUM
E
RATE_
A
LL_EXT to
k
ens to al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Chris Robi
n
so
n
Add
AL_LOKI_WAVE_f
o
rmat tokens to
a
lext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Chris Robins
o
n
Add ALC_LOKI_audio_chann
e
l
tok
e
ns to al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Chris Robinson
Store extension l
i
s
t
with a pointer, not a
per-context
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Ch
r
is Robi
n
son
Set the
n
e
w
linking pol
i
cy f
o
r
CMake 2
.
6 to
a
v
o
id
w
arnings
commit
|
commitdiff
|
tree
2008-07-18
Chris Robinson
D
o
n't for
c
e
ini
t
ialization
w
he
n
s
hutting down
commit
|
commitdiff
|
tree
2008-07-18
Chris Robin
s
on
Move (de)initiali
z
ation
i
nto ALc
.
c and
r
emov
e
unn
e
e
ded
.
.
.
commit
|
commitdiff
|
tree
2008-07-15
C
h
ris Robinson
Implement
d
oppl
e
r f
a
cto
r
source propert
y
commit
|
commitdiff
|
tree
2008-07-15
Chris Robinson
A
dd the reverb room rollo
f
f t
o
the source room r
o
lloff
.
.
.
commit
|
commitdiff
|
tree
2008-07-11
Chri
s
Ro
b
ins
o
n
Do
n
'
t check the
numbe
r
of objects bei
n
g deleted w
i
th
.
.
.
commit
|
commitdiff
|
tree
2008-07-11
Chris
Robinson
Use
vo
l
atile fo
r
me
m
b
er variab
l
es t
h
at are c
h
anged
.
.
.
commit
|
commitdiff
|
tree
2008-07-09
Chr
i
s Robinson
Reduce the mix buf
f
er sizes by half
commit
|
commitdiff
|
tree
2008-07-03
Chris
Robinson
Leave SourceToListener untra
n
sformed for
use wit
h
untran
s
for
.
.
.
commit
|
commitdiff
|
tree
2008-06-18
Chris Robinso
n
S
t
ore thread re
t
urn value in the str
u
ct to av
o
id voi
d
.
.
.
commit
|
commitdiff
|
tree
2008-06-07
Chris Robinson
A
l
low for overrid
i
ng the default
lib d
e
stination with
.
.
.
commit
|
commitdiff
|
tree
2008-06-07
Chris Ro
b
inso
n
Make the pro
j
ect ex
p
li
c
i
tly C
commit
|
commitdiff
|
tree
next